Autobiography Outlier Army Commander’s Bumping Trot
Overview

“Outlier Army Commander’s Bumping Trot” is the forthcoming autobiography of Lt Gen (Dr) Kamal Jit Singh (Retd)—a highly decorated Indian Army officer, former GOC-in-Chief, Western Command, and respected national security thinker.

The autobiography will chronicle an unconventional military journey, marked by operational command, institutional leadership, intellectual independence, and a steadfast commitment to service. It promises an honest, reflective, and unsanitised account of life in uniform—viewed from the perspective of an officer who often operated outside conventional templates.

What “Outlier” Means

The term “Outlier” reflects a career shaped not by conformity, but by:

  • Independent thinking within rigid systems
  • Moral courage in leadership decisions
  • A willingness to question established assumptions
  • Balancing obedience with professional integrity

Lt Gen K.J. Singh’s career trajectory, responsibilities, and post-retirement intellectual engagement place him distinctly outside the predictable mould—making this narrative both rare and relevant.

The Meaning of “Bumping Trot”

“Bumping Trot,” a term drawn from equestrian movement, symbolises:

  • Forward motion despite uneven terrain
  • Progress marked by jolts, resistance, and course corrections
  • Resilience under pressure and constant adaptation

As a metaphor, it captures the rhythm of a military life shaped by conflict zones, command challenges, institutional dynamics, and personal evolution.
